In metropolitan construction tasks, numerous types of scaffolding are utilized to offer important support and precaution for workers running at raised heights. The historic development of scaffolding in cities showcases a progression from basic wood frameworks to contemporary steel frameworks that are functional and strong. Social value also plays a role in the sorts of scaffolding utilized, with some cities including standard designs that show their heritage and building design.
Common sorts of scaffolding located in cities consist of tube and coupler scaffolding, which is versatile and can be adapted to various urban environments. Equipments scaffolding, such as cup-lock scaffolding, provides a fast and efficient option for skyscraper building tasks. In addition, framework scaffolding is usually made use of in cities for its simplicity of setting up and stability when working with buildings with straight facades.
Comprehending the historical advancement and cultural significance of various sorts of scaffolding is essential in city building to make certain that frameworks are erected safely and effectively in diverse city landscapes.
Urban building projects heavily count on strict precaution to make sure the well-being of workers. Safety and security considerations related to scaffolding frameworks are particularly critical, with a crucial focus on complete inspection protocols. Normal assessments assist to recognize potential threats such as loose fittings, damaged components, or improper assembly. This proactive technique guarantees that any type of problems are immediately addressed prior to they position risks to employees.
An additional crucial safety measure is the application of clear emergency response procedures. In case of a mishap or architectural failure, employees should understand how to react swiftly and safely. This preparedness includes having actually assigned setting up factors, easily available emergency get in touch with info, and regular drills to practice reaction actions. By emphasizing examination protocols and emergency reaction readiness, city construction tasks can develop a much safer working environment, thus decreasing the threat of accidents and injuries on-site.

With innovations in building and construction technology and products, the evolution of scaffolding in city settings is placed to revolutionize the effectiveness and safety and security standards of future tasks. The future trends in metropolitan scaffolding are as follows:
Consolidation of Sustainable Layout: Future city scaffolding will prioritize lasting materials and practices, intending to decrease environmental influence and advertise eco-friendly building procedures.
Integration of Technical Advancements: Scaffolding systems will significantly integrate technological advancements such as sensors for real-time surveillance of structural stability and security, enhancing general job effectiveness.
Modular and Functional Designs: Scaffolding frameworks will certainly embrace modular and adaptable designs, permitting fast assembly, disassembly, and reconfiguration to suit the certain demands of varied metropolitan construction projects.
Enhanced Security Functions: Future urban scaffolding will certainly concentrate on integrating enhanced safety features, such as automatic loss avoidance systems and enhanced security devices, to assure a protected working environment for construction employees.
